Best insurance?

Like many, I’m sure, I had planned to travel in Europe this Summer (I’m in the UK) - these plans are now on hold. The BBC has told travellers of all types to contact their insurance companies in the first instance to see what they can do regarding potential refunds. I contacted my insurance company (I’ll not mention which one purposely, as I don’t want to derail my question) to ask them about potential recourse, they weren’t even slightly interested; flatly refused to even discuss anything (and I was only putting out feelers of possibility, not even asking for anything specifically!). I appreciate the fact they’re a business and all associated conversations.

My question (sorry for the preamble) is are there ANY insurance companies that would take into account the UK foreign office statements regarding recourse to things like the travel bans in place at the moment? Perhaps none of them do this? Which ones do you rate? My current one doesn’t take theee things into account - I’ll read the small print more carefully in the future!

Thanks in advance for your suggestions.

We're talking about travel insurance, not vehicle insurance - is that right? If it is here's my recent experience. I bought travel insurance for a USA bike trip back in early March (ie before lockdown). The trip itself was due to happen in early April and fell foul of the lockdown so I couldn't travel. I contacted the insurance company - Holiday Extras - to ask them what's happening to the policy as I'm not allowed to travel and the flight has been cancelled (the most important bit).

It took some doing as their staff were all working from home so not answering phone calls and, for a while, not responding to emails. When they came back to me (10 days ago) they said as I hadn't claimed for anything, and wasn't going to claim, I could choose between 50% of the premium back or defer the policy into the future. When I chose the latter (we still want to do the trip, but who knows when) they said there will be a £50 'admin' surcharge ... Better than nothing but not much as the flight was refunded completely and I'm sure they have as much 'admin' to do as the insurance companies.
